Background:

Quinidine-d3 is intended for use as an internal standard for the quantification of quinidine by GC- or LC-MS. Quinidine is a stereoisomer of the antimalarial agent quinine and a class Ia antiarrhythmic agent.1,2 Quinidine blocks the voltage-gated sodium (Nav) channel Nav1.5 in a use-dependent manner.1 It decreases the amplitude and duration of action potentials in isolated canine ventricular myocytes.3 Quinidine inhibits KKr, peak INa, and late INa (IC50s = 4.5, 11, and 12 μM, respectively) and can induce torsade de pointes in isolated rabbit hearts when used at a concentration of 1 μM.2 It induces QT prolongation in dogs.4 Quinidine also binds to M2 muscarinic acetylcholine receptors (Ki = 7.5 μM for human recombinant receptors expressed in HM2-B10 cells).5 Formulations containing quinidine have been used in the treatment of atrial fibrillation and ventricular arrhythmias.
